Highlight of Cruzeiro, Cássio will return, for the first time, to Neo Chemistry Arena, one of the main stages of his career, to rediscover Corinthians and the fans alvinegra. The duel will be this Thursday (23), at 19:30 (Brasília), for the 16th round of Serie A of the Brazilian Championship.
The archer could not face in the Brazilian last year and will now live the unprecedented experience. In the first round, he was not yet legal to act, while in the return he was spared by Fernando Diniz, eyeing the decision of the South American Cup.
Troubled outlet
Cassio left the course to Cruzeiro in May 2024, after having the image worn at the club. Following flaws, painful defeats, lots of pressure, and impactful statements ended the story that seemed eternal.
Shirt 1, which wore 12 in Itaquera, could not resist the bad general phase that the alvinegro club crossed, on and off the pitch. More than not surrender on the pitch, the idol began to live with mental health problems and had depression.
“That’s what I lived at Corinthians, when I left Corinthians. Today, looking more calmly, it was the best thing for both sides. I had no strength to help at that time and was in a deep depression,” Cássio said in an interview with Cruzeiro Cast in early July.

Cassio for Corinthians
Cassio was definitely transferred to Corinthians in 2012 after a passage in Dutch football. He gained space with Tite and, from then on, made history being a key player in several titles, such as the Copa Libertadores and the Club World Cup in the same year. Subsequently, the goalkeeper still won four Paulista Championships (2013, 2017, 2018 and 2019), two Brazilian championships (2015 and 2017) and a South American Recopa (2013).
In all, the goalkeeper stayed at the club for 12 years and ended his spell with 712 games. He is the second athlete with more performances by Corinthians in history.
